SafeIntException 类

SafeInt 类使用 SafeIntException 来确定数学运算为什么无法完成。

注意

有关此库的最新版本,请访问 https://github.com/dcleblanc/SafeInt

语法

class SafeIntException;

成员

公共构造函数

名称 描述
SafeIntException::SafeIntException 创建一个 SafeIntException 对象。

备注

SafeInt 类是唯一使用 SafeIntException 类的类。

继承层次结构

SafeIntException

要求

头:safeint.h

命名空间:msl:: utilities

SafeIntException::SafeIntException

创建一个 SafeIntException 对象。

SafeIntException();

SafeIntException(
   SafeIntError code
);

参数

code
[输入] 描述所发生错误的枚举数据值。

备注

文件 Safeint.h 中定义了 code 的可取值。 为了方便起见,此处还列出了可取值。

  • SafeIntNoError
  • SafeIntArithmeticOverflow
  • SafeIntDivideByZero